Output ed68eff6212331232ad290c8b2247f32018e9f51c7534d248fd83b1ade326bb8:1

value
3562493
script pubkey
OP_0 OP_PUSHBYTES_20 89f25db32c2462431c8f0949eac9ca79ebd2e66f
address
bc1q38e9mvevy33yx8y0p9y74jw2084a9en0uy2pj0
transaction
ed68eff6212331232ad290c8b2247f32018e9f51c7534d248fd83b1ade326bb8
spent
true